Output 77f966d6145dca1b010a31c6f41e90fbdfd17ba080fdbf577ee089a174610022:1

value
42464080
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c868f37a4eab5a5c051c3ec6983938be3d90d1ed OP_EQUALVERIFY OP_CHECKSIG
address
1KGfsVjDx4xWseTr3uuraGdi34QLse3zLG
transaction
77f966d6145dca1b010a31c6f41e90fbdfd17ba080fdbf577ee089a174610022
confirmations
278581
spent
true